Cannot inactivate email b/c used by login

Hi Friends,

We had an odd occurrence.  A patron contacted our box office saying when she logs in to our website with her email address it says her name is Eileen Wilcox, when really her name is Linda Corcorran.  I went into Eileen Wilcox's account, and sure enough Linda's email address is in her record and it can not be inactivated because it is used by a login.

I don't know how this happened, but would like to fix it.  After some researching, I think this will be a SQL task, but wondering if anyone can tell me what needs to be done.

    Also make sure you have rights via the security module that allow you (your usergroup) to edit and delete logins (Const Login RB object, I believe). This thread today made me realize that our users only had view rights, and you have to explicitly allow edit and delete permissions to do what your asking. A true admin login should implicitly allow you to do all those things. All other users need explicit permissions to do so.
